The article addresses the risks associated with the spread of homemade peptide injections used for weight loss, muscle building, and improving sexual health, noting their increasing popularity despite insufficient regulation. It explains that many of these products are sold online without adhering to safety and efficacy standards, exposing users to risks such as contamination, inaccurate dosages, and serious health injuries resulting from improper preparation or unsafe injection practices. The study also highlights that a lack of training and overconfidence among users may further elevate the risks of infection and bleeding. While recent recommendations from the U.S. Food and Drug Administration (FDA) to allow certain peptides to be sold in pharmacies could improve safety, they are not yet officially approved, thus maintaining the hazards associated with an unregulated peptide market.
